The trim around your home isn’t just decorative. It seals the edges where your roof, siding, windows, and doors meet, keeping moisture, drafts, and pests from reaching the vulnerable layers underneath. When that barrier starts to crack, warp, or pull away, the damage behind it can escalate quickly and quietly.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is included in trim work?

    Trim work covers the installation and repair of exterior boards, casings, and molding across several key areas of your home:

    • Window and door frames
    • Corner boards
    • Rake and frieze boards
    • Fascia and soffit transition pieces
    • Decorative exterior molding or accent boards

    Each component helps seal your home against moisture, drafts, and pests. The full scope depends on your property’s condition. Our team in Coastal Maine can assess what’s needed and recommend the right approach.

  • Is trim work difficult?

    Trim work demands precision, patience, and hands-on experience that most homeowners simply don’t have. Every cut needs to be exact, every joint tight, and every board fitted to account for how materials expand and contract with the seasons.

    On top of that, choosing the right products for a coastal climate means understanding how moisture, salt air, and temperature swings affect different options over time. Getting even one detail wrong can lead to gaps that invite water and pests into your home.
